CVE-2025-20059 impacts Ping Identity

CVE-2025-20059 impacts Ping Identity


CVE-2025-20059 represents a critical security vulnerability known as a Relative Path Traversal flaw, which impacts the Ping Identity PingAM Java Policy Agent. This vulnerability allows for parameter injection, enabling attackers to manipulate file paths and gain unauthorized access to protected resources, effectively bypassing policy enforcement mechanisms.

Overview of CVE-2025-20059

Description

  • Vulnerability: CVE-2025-20059 is categorized as a Relative Path Traversal vulnerability within the Ping Identity PingAM Java Policy Agent. This flaw permits parameter injection, leading to unauthorized access to file paths and resources that should otherwise be protected.
  • Impact: The vulnerability affects all supported versions of the PingAM Java Agent, specifically versions 5.10.3 and earlier, 2023.11.1 and earlier, and 2024.9 and earlier. It’s also probable that older, unsupported versions may be susceptible to this flaw.

Technical Mechanics

Exploitation

  • Attack Vector: The vulnerability can be exploited by remote attackers without requiring any form of authentication. By crafting specific HTTP requests, attackers can manipulate the file paths processed by the PingAM Java Policy Agent, leading to the bypass of policy enforcement mechanisms.
  • Conditions for Exploitation: Successful exploitation of this vulnerability requires attackers to inject specially crafted parameters into requests sent to the PingAM Java Policy Agent. These parameters exploit the path traversal flaw, allowing access to unauthorized resources.

Proof of Concept (PoC)

  • Public PoC: A proof-of-concept (PoC) code has been released to demonstrate the exploitation of this vulnerability. The PoC showcases how attackers can craft specific parameters to manipulate file paths and bypass policy enforcement. This publicly available code underscores the importance of addressing this vulnerability promptly.

Mitigation Measures

Immediate Actions

  • Patch Management: Users of the PingAM Java Policy Agent must urgently update their instances to the latest versions provided by Ping Identity. Applying these security patches is crucial for mitigating the risks associated with CVE-2025-20059.
  • Access Control: Organizations should implement robust access controls to restrict interactions with the PingAM Java Policy Agent to trusted internal networks only. By limiting access to authorized personnel, the risk of exploitation can be significantly reduced.

Long-Term Strategies

  • Regular Security Audits: Conducting regular security audits and vulnerability assessments is essential for identifying and addressing potential weaknesses within the IT infrastructure. These proactive measures help maintain a secure environment and ensure that vulnerabilities are promptly mitigated.
  • Network Segmentation: Implementing network segmentation strategies can limit the lateral movement of attackers and contain the impact of potential breaches. By isolating critical systems within segmented networks, organizations can reduce the risk of widespread compromise.
  • Behavioral Analysis: Deploying behavioral analysis tools enables the monitoring of unusual system behavior and network traffic patterns that may indicate a compromise. These tools provide real-time insights, allowing for rapid detection and response to security incidents.
  • Incident Response Planning: Developing and maintaining a comprehensive incident response plan is critical for effectively responding to security incidents. Regular testing and updating of the plan ensure preparedness and resilience against potential threats, enabling organizations to mitigate the impact of breaches swiftly.

Final Thoughts

CVE-2025-20059 is a critical vulnerability that poses a significant risk to organizations using the Ping Identity PingAM Java Policy Agent. By understanding the nature of this vulnerability and implementing the recommended mitigation measures, organizations can better protect their systems from potential exploitation. Vigilance and proactive security measures are essential for safeguarding against such vulnerabilities.

Comments

No comments yet. Why don’t you start the discussion?

    Leave a Reply

    This site uses Akismet to reduce spam. Learn how your comment data is processed.